I have a right hand drive 1999 E300 turbo diesel.

I have an Air Con problem, and have done lots of searches in the Forum. It seems quite common. It's the " left side hot, right side cold" issue.

According to the many posts it's one of two problems, Duo Valve or low on A/C gas.

I took the advice on one of the previous posts and gave the Duo Valve a wack (well, several wacks actually, with the palm of my hand while the engine is running and the A/C on) and the right side is now hot.

And now, when I try setting both sides to cold, the left side gets cold quite quickly and the right side stays hot !

So, to my questions,
1 - Does that sound like a DuoValve problem?
2 - Is the DuoValve servicable; i.e. rather than buying a new one, can I take it off and try fixing it? If so, any tips/gotchas, what is actually inside it ?
3 - How do I check the fault codes on the car? Many of the forum posts have stated that the driver has managed to check the fault codes themselves, and even seen the A/C gas pressure. How do I do that?
4 - My wifes Uncle is an air con expert, but not a mechanic. He will top it up for me, but he won't do it unless I tell him what gas, where the "fill point" is, what pressue to set, and if there are any other details he should know. Cos he doesn't want to do any damage.

Duo Valve.
Simple to take to pieces and clean so long as you have some DIY skills.
Afraid I can't attach a pic but the DuoValve but it is two small cylinders with attachged wires in the return hoses from the heater sited in the rear or side of theengine compartment.
The valve is basically an electric solenoid. The solenoid must be working OK since ytou have got it to switch from OFF to ON so I guess it is some form of corrosion between the moving parts of the solenoid.
Of course you could buy new ones but I'd have a go at reworking them .
